very good question Larry. Men have been debating and discussing this very question for thousands of yrs. The thought of a rapist, murderer going to heaven is hard for human beings to comprehend. They wont get there with words of accepting Christ. But like Dino says, Christ forgave the criminal on the cross beside him. It's a heart transformation that will save you. Not deeds( thats hard for us to understand too) From my studies and understanding the only sin that is unforgivable is rejecting the offer of salvation. But the truth is you can murder,rape, steal and if God has blessed you with a call of salvation on your deathbed then Yes...you will go to heaven. The thing is.......do you really want to take that chance.
